Output 714ab2ee1fba790bcd194860927f36eee84d118bcb2f8a0b1d335b67677626b9:0

value
10867131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a17982b9824544eda9a31a381ecdc81265298c OP_EQUAL
address
3EL2cUKMYTmBKmGiNS3493g9j8QQ1zzJEj
transaction
714ab2ee1fba790bcd194860927f36eee84d118bcb2f8a0b1d335b67677626b9
confirmations
390766
spent
true